Dickey Center gets a new director.

“The United States and all nations are grappling with profound problems that no country can solve alone,” says Victoria Holt. “The work of the Dickey Center to engage the Dartmouth community, promote understanding of these complex matters, and support action is essential.” Currently VP of the Stimson Center, a Washington, D.C., public policy research institute focused on international affairs, Holt starts her new
job September 1.
